RSD- Telangana news: On 17.09.2023 in local 3rd ward under the Telangana state government and in local 30th ward under the Srinidhi Mutual Co-operative Society, the President of Municipal Corporation Mrs. Jindam Kalachakrapani was present as the Chief Guest and distributed Vinayaka idols.

Moreover, we would like to express our special thanks to Chief Minister KCR who is organizing a great program like Haritaharam in the state and giving high priority to environmental protection, for designing the distribution program of clay Ganesha idols across the state of Telangana in order to respect our cultural traditions and also protect the environment.
Similarly, he said that all the people should worship Vigneshwara made of clay with devotion and follow the rules and regulations and avoid worshiping Lord Ganesha made of materials that cause pollution of the earth and water on the occasion of Vinayaka Chavati as much as possible and teach the future generations the greatness of Hindu divinity and the responsibility of environmental protection.
